Can I change the default folder for "returns" file that is saved when I exit Turbo Tax? Can I cut and paste the existing file (1st session) to the new folder?
I am concerned that if I cut and paste the existing "returns" file then I may not being able to continue with Turbo Tax in completing my returns.
Can I change the default folder for "returns" file that is saved when I exit Turbo Tax? Can I cut and paste the existing file (1st session) to the new folder?
You can save the .tax20?? file anywhere you want. The only requirement, is that it has to be on the same drive the program is installed on. Typically, that's drive C:. Otherwise, you may have issues with opening the file, or e-filing it.
